Background technique
With the fast development of the interconnection technique of electric system, the electric system of long distance power transmission has obtained widely answering
With.During remote Operation of Electric Systems, it is easy to be influenced by factors such as environment, workload demands, system shake occurs
The problem of swinging, the performances such as system stability contorting performance, alternating current-direct current mixing electric network coordination, power flowcontrol ability caused to decline.It is existing
Using static synchronous series compensator (Static Synchronous Series Compensator, SSSC), uniformly in technology
Flow controller (Interline between flow controller (Unified Power Flow Controller, UPFC) and line
Power Flow Controller, IPFC), the control devices such as convertible static compensator solve above-mentioned technical problem.
Currently, the access for static synchronous series compensator or UPFC influences aspect to harmonics in the prior art
Document has: " THE UPFC and its influence to relay protection ", " THE UPFC and its shadow for protection of adjusting the distance
Ring ", the adaptive distance protection of the route containing THE UPFC " study ", patent document has: application number
CN201510732288.6 and a kind of entitled distance protecting method for the transmission line of electricity containing THE UPFC,
Application number CN201610309848.1 and the entitled rapid distance protection method for power transmission line containing UPFC and device, application
Number CN201510371762.7 and a kind of entitled electricity with THE UPFC transmission line of electricity based on pattern-recognition
Flow transient direction protection method, application number CN201510371647.X and entitled a kind of with THE UPFC
The method for protecting transient state energy of transmission line of electricity.
But above-mentioned existing literature mainly according to the working principle of SSSC, UPFC, IPFC or convertible static compensator and
Characteristic optimizes the defencive function of the line protective device of route distance protection, but does not consider to work as electric system
Response characteristic is protected in the control of the equipment such as SSSC, UPFC, IPFC or convertible static compensator when failure, affects route protection
Equipment does not have engineering practicability to the distance protection performance of transmission line of electricity in electric system.

The circuit connecting mode of the UPFC used in embodiments of the present invention a kind of can be as shown in Figure 6, the UPFC's
Circuit may include: current transformer 43, the Quick side of series connection inverter 41, series transformer 42, inverter output end of connecting
Way switch 44, compensator access bus 45, bus-bar potential transformer 46, series transformer output end voltage transformer 47
With the current transformer 48, mechanical bypass switch 49, parallel inverter 410 of series transformer output end.The corresponding UPFC of Fig. 6
The equivalent circuit diagram of circuit can be as shown in Figure 7, wherein further include in the corresponding circuit structure of Fig. 7 in Fig. 6 it is unshowned simultaneously
Join the current transformer 411 of inverter outlet side and the voltage transformer 412 of parallel inverter outlet side.Specifically, series connection is changed
The current transformer 43 of stream device output end is used to obtain the electric current of series connection inverter, and bus-bar potential transformer 46 is for obtaining compensation
The voltage of the bus 45 of device access, the voltage transformer 47 of series transformer output end are used to obtain the route of compensator access
Voltage, the current transformer 48 of series transformer output end is used to obtain the electric current of the route of compensator access, and parallel connection is changed
The current transformer 411 of stream device outlet side is used to obtain the electric current of parallel inverter, the mutual induction of voltage of parallel inverter outlet side
Device 412 is used to obtain the voltage of parallel inverter.Quick by-pass switch 44 is in parallel with series transformer 42, is connected to series-transformer
Device inputs end side, and mechanical bypass switch 49 is also in parallel with series transformer 42, is connected to series transformer output end, Quick side
The connection type of way switch 44 and mechanical bypass switch 49 and series transformer can be as shown in Figure 6.It should be noted that Quick side
Way switch 44 is in parallel with series transformer 42, is connected to series transformer output end, i.e., in parallel with mechanical bypass switch 49 to connect
Connect the output end (being not shown in Fig. 6) in series transformer 42.
